The honeymoon is over, so to speak. Six months into her relationship with the Alpha’s Caine and Stavros, Abigail is frustrated and hurt by their not turning her into a wolf. Stavros is for it, Caine is not. Happy in her relationship with her wolves in every way but this one, the strain is beginning to chip away at the foundation of the happy relationship the three created.
Caine is opposed to Abigail being turned because he is convinced she is too “human". Afraid of hurting her by showing his dominant side he is instead hurting her more by his behavior and erratic moods. Stavros accepts Abigail for who and what she is, and what she is meant to become as mate to both him and his brother; submissive.
Again, save us all from a man who thinks he knows what is best for the little woman. I could have just smacked Caine on more than one occasion for his chauvinistic attitude and sometimes arrogant handling of Abigail and her feelings. Stavros was a sweety throughout and I could just take him home. The scenes of intimacy between the three were scorching and provocative, and the individual encounters between Abigail and her men also hot, if not hotter. Caine’s journey to accept Abigail was painful to read sometimes, but made for an entertaining view into an Alpha’s psyche. A solid read.
